Drop rate of off shape gems is about 1.5%, off those you need 18 rating gems, of those they need to not be "warm" gems and of those, they need to have a usable curse. I'm at about 2,000 kills and have only gotten 1 radial 31.5% with kin down (beast down is also fine) 2 radial 31.5% with stamina down 1 Triangle 31.5% with stamina down The rest weren't usable.

Yharnam Sunrise. It's a boring ending, but the only one which presents any kind of positive outcome for your hunter. You wake up, freed from the dream, the nightmare of blood and beasts is over, you did some monumental things that you can now forget because it's stuff man was not meant to know.
Becoming the new Gehrman is a terribly tragic ending and the most futile, all your actions were seemingly for not. You're now a slave to the Nightmare and the nameless Moon Presence. You're going to sit in that chair for countless eons and rot and your memory fade like Gehrman's.
Becoming a squid is the most interesting, and most risky. You achieved what Byrgenwerth and the Church never could, you became a squid and seemingly have achieved the evolution sought by so many now dead madmen. But of course that's just a human perspective on it. Do you really, truly know exactly what you've done? Or what you've become? All for the loss of your humanity, to embrace the Nightmare and the alien horror that has now consumed three civilizations. Will you perpetuate it? End it? Misuse it? Fix it? Who knows. Alternatively, you played right into someone's hands and become the Nightmare Newborn, the surrogate child for the Doll, or who even knows, Oedon.
